This document describes the BEA Connect TPS product and gives instructions for using the tools for building Connect TPS applications.
BEA Connect TPS is a gateway connectivity feature that enables application programs on BEA TUXEDO systems to perform various non-transactional tasks with application programs that reside on different kinds of computers.

This guide is primarily for system administrators who will configure and administer Connect TPS. In addition, programmers will find useful pointers for developing client programs and service routines that send data through Connect TPS.
Programmers and system administrators who work with Connect TPS should be familiar with the concept of distributed multi-tier client/server processing.
